App::uses('ObjectCollection', 'Utility');

/**
 * Registry of loaded log engines
 *
 * @package       Cake.Log
 */
class LogEngineCollection extends ObjectCollection {

/**
 * Loads/constructs a Log engine.
 *
 * @param string $name instance identifier
 * @param array $options Setting for the Log Engine
 * @return BaseLog BaseLog engine instance
 * @throws CakeLogException when logger class does not implement a write method
 */
        public function load($name, $options = array()) {
                $enable = isset($options['enabled']) ? $options['enabled'] : true;
                $loggerName = $options['engine'];
                unset($options['engine']);
                $className = $this->_getLogger($loggerName);
                $logger = new $className($options);
                if (!$logger instanceof CakeLogInterface) {
                        throw new CakeLogException(
                                __d('cake_dev', 'logger class %s does not implement a %s method.', $loggerName, 'write()')
                        );
                }
                $this->_loaded[$name] = $logger;
                if ($enable) {
                        $this->enable($name);
                }
                return $logger;
        }

/**
 * Attempts to import a logger class from the various paths it could be on.
 * Checks that the logger class implements a write method as well.
 *
 * @param string $loggerName the plugin.className of the logger class you want to build.
 * @return mixed boolean false on any failures, string of classname to use if search was successful.
 * @throws CakeLogException
 */
        protected static function _getLogger($loggerName) {
                list($plugin, $loggerName) = pluginSplit($loggerName, true);
                if (substr($loggerName, -3) !== 'Log') {
                        $loggerName .= 'Log';
                }
                App::uses($loggerName, $plugin . 'Log/Engine');
                if (!class_exists($loggerName)) {
                        throw new CakeLogException(__d('cake_dev', 'Could not load class %s', $loggerName));
                }
                return $loggerName;
        }

}
